A Reversed-Phase HPLC Method for Determination of Osteopontin in Infant Formula

Abstract: Osteopontin (OPN) is a multifunctional whey protein which has recently received much attention for possibly applications in fortifying infant milk formula (IMF) with its bioactivity. However, to date, there is no established high-performance liquid chromatography (HPLC) method to quantify this protein in milk or IMF. In this study, a rapid, simple, isocratic and reliable reversed-phase HPLC method was developed and validated to quantify the OPN in IMF. “…method for intact OPN analysis was presented in a recent paper. 21 However, it showed several critical flaws: (1) It used one of the above Sigma materials as its reference standard, which might lead to inaccurate quantification. (2) It failed to show chromatographic baseline separation between the OPN and other interferences from the infant formula matrix and also did not present any other method specificity or selectivity tests to prove the purity of the targeted OPN peak.…”
